Output f6e21a63df5ea14e698fa4d1a120e3c2fca7704a97e5141da34353b961c02693:1

value
810510636
script pubkey
OP_0 OP_PUSHBYTES_20 298dff474759a37f596dca5c40d2ef58a1594eec
address
bc1q9xxl7368tx3h7ktdefwyp5h0tzs4jnhvtky0r9
transaction
f6e21a63df5ea14e698fa4d1a120e3c2fca7704a97e5141da34353b961c02693